Lon Stringfield
Lon Stringfield is a lake in Coconino County, Arizona and has an elevation of 5,433 feet. Lon Stringfield is situated nearby to the area Granite Basin Viewpoint, as well as near the neighborhood Granite Basin Summer Homes.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Iron Springs
Hamlet
Iron Springs is an unincorporated community in central Yavapai County, Arizona, United States, in the Prescott National Forest. It lies along Iron Springs Road northwest of the city of Prescott, the county seat of Yavapai County. Iron Springs is situated 4 miles southwest of Lon Stringfield.

Williamson
Village
Williamson is a census-designated place in Yavapai County, Arizona, United States. The population was 3,776 at the 2000 census and 6,196 at the 2020 census. Williamson is situated 4½ miles north of Lon Stringfield.
